You guys were probably thinking the relationship between Audi and Porsche is probably on the rocks since Audi handels Volkswagen’s premium and performance division. Well to kill that speculation, Audi and Porsche will be joining forces on an entry level mid-engined Audi R4 coupe and roadster, as well as the next-generation Boxter and Cayman.

As reported before, Audi will be making a lineup of four ‘R’ badged cars including the R8 with a roadster variant, R4, R6 and an R10. While the Audi R6 will sit between the Porche 911 and Boxter, the Audi R4 will be an entry-level mid-engined car with a price bracket between £28-35,000.

While Porsche will be helping Audi with the R4, Audi will give their two cents for the next-generation Boxter/Cayman codenamed 981/C8. According to sources over at CarMagazine the Audi R4 will have a 2.5 liter 5-cylinder engine that produces up to 300 horsepower. The next Porsche Boxter may get an Audi spin-off with a quattro all-wheel-drive system.

Porsche and Audi will be sharing development costs, technology, Audi’s aluminium spaceframe bodies, powerful diesel engines, lightweight low-friction four-wheel drive with torque vectoring and dual clutch transmissions for almost all torque classes.

The only conflict between the two is timing. While Porsche has its work cut out until 2012 with the next Cayman and then the Cayenne hybrid, Audi wants the R4 to arrive in the market in 2010 (one year after the Porsche Panamera hits the roads).

Expect the Audi TT Clubsport quattro to play a huge roll in all this which was inspired by Porsche’s 356 Speedster.
